The Itinerary Breakdown
The tour is designed to give you a balanced taste of Destin’s aquatic appeal. It begins in Destin Harbor, where the Captain will tailor the cruise to your interests. Here, you can expect to see dolphins — a highlight for many travelers — and enjoy the lively scenery of boats, waterfront restaurants, and the harbor’s bustling activity.
The second stop is Crab Island, the star of the show. Located just north of the Destin Bridge in Choctawhatchee Bay, this area is famous for its shallow, clear waters and floating platforms. Expect to anchor here for about three hours, giving you ample time to relax, swim, or float around. It’s perfect for families and groups wanting to soak up the sun or enjoy water games.

Duration and Timing
The tour can last anywhere from 4 to 8 hours, giving you options for a quick afternoon trip or a full-day adventure. The typical itinerary involves about an hour cruising Destin Harbor and dolphin spotting, followed by a three-hour stop at Crab Island. All this is navigated smoothly, and the tour ends back at the starting point, making logistics simple.
Potential Drawbacks
While the experience is generally well-received, there are some hiccups. One reviewer mentioned difficulty reaching the staff via phone or text but appreciated that the company later clarified the boarding location, which was different from the initial address. This highlights the importance of confirming details closer to your booking date and being adaptable.
Weather can also impact plans. Since the tour is weather-dependent, poor conditions might mean a reschedule or refund, which is standard practice but something to keep in mind if traveling during uncertain weather.
